What was found in ZIP 98629
The highest level seen across the suppliers serving this ZIP, the EPA limit for each, and where the figure comes from.
| Contaminant | Level vs EPA limit | Suppliers |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| Nitrate | 2800 µg/L 28% of the EPA limit 10000 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Nitrate-Nitrite | 2220 µg/L 22% of the EPA limit 10000 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Fluoride | 240 µg/L 6% of the EPA limit 4000 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Barium | 78.9 µg/L 3.9% of the EPA limit 2000 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Copper | 50 µg/L 3.8% of the EPA limit 1300 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Total Haloacetic Acids (HAA5) | 21.2 µg/L 35% of the EPA limit 60 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Trichloroacetic Acid | 15 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Dichloroacetic Acid | 7.2 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| TTHM | 6.05 µg/L 7.6% of the EPA limit 80 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Arsenic | 6 µg/L 60% of the EPA limit 10 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Chromium | 4 µg/L 4% of the EPA limit 100 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Gross Beta Particle Activity | 3.3 pCi/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Chloroform | 3.2 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Bromodichloromethane | 2 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Dibromochloromethane | 1.2 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| 1,1,1-Trichloroethane | 1.1 µg/L 0.6% of the EPA limit 200 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| 1,1-Dichloroethylene | 1.1 µg/L 16% of the EPA limit 7 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Bromoform | 0.5500 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Xylenes, Total | 0.5100 µg/L 0% of the EPA limit 10000 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| Trichloroethylene | 0.5000 µg/L 10% of the EPA limit 5 µg/L | 1/1 | SYR4 |
| PFOS | 0.0084 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| UCMR-5 |
| PFOA | 0.0080 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| UCMR-5 |
| PFHXS | 0.0053 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| UCMR-5 |
| PFBS | 0.0041 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| UCMR-5 |
| Pfhxa | 0.0033 µg/L No EPA limit set | 1/1 | UCMR-5 |
| Lead | 0.0018 mg/L 12% of the EPA limit 0.0150 mg/L | 1/1 | LCR |

Frequently asked questions about ZIP 98629 tap water
Is the tap water in ZIP 98629 safe to drink?
EPA testing detected 26 contaminants across the water suppliers serving ZIP 98629. A detection isn't the same as a violation — most levels are within federal limits. See each level and source above, and your utility's annual Consumer Confidence Report for the official status.
